Warning Signs You Need Laminate Floor Water Damage Restoration
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ems down the line. Don’t ignore these warning signs, and you’ll be glad you didn’t.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can show the presence of mold and mildew. If you notice these smells persisting after cleaning, it’s time to call a professional for Laminate Floor Water Damage Restoration.
Warping or Buckling Laminate Floors
Warped or buckling laminate floors can be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ore this warning sign, as it can lead to further damage and costly repairs.
Visible Water Stains or Discoloration
Visible water stains or discoloration on your laminate floors can show the presence of water damage. Don’t delay in addressing this issue to prevent further damage.
Peeling or Cracking Laminate Flooring
Peeling or cracking laminate fl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ice this issue, it’s time to call a professional for Laminate Floor Water Damage Restoration.
Soft or Spongy Laminate Floors
Soft or spongy laminate floors can show the presence of water damage. Don’t delay in addressing this issue to prevent further damage.

Laminate Floor Water Damage Restoration Cost in Broadlands, VA
The cost of Laminate Floor Water Damage Restoration services in Broadlands, VA, var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on typical prices and may not reflect your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Inspection and Assessment | $100 – $500 | The complexity of the damage and the size of the affected area. |
| Water Extraction and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| The amount of water extracted and the type of drying equipment used. |
| Moisture Testing and Cleanup | $200 – $1,000 | The extent of the damage and the type of cleanup required. |
| Final Inspection and Report | $100 – $500 | The complexity of the damage and the type of report required. |
